Original Description
Anna Ancher's Kvinde, der sidder og fletter sit hår (Woman Braiding Her Hair) captivates with its intimate tranquility. Painted around 1890 during the Danish Skagen artists' heyday, the work exemplifies interiørmalerier (interior scenes)—a signature subject for Ancher, who masterfully balanced naturalism with poetic light. The composition centers on a woman absorbed in her daily ritual, bathed in warm, diffused sunlight that filters through a window, illuminating her auburn hair and the textured folds of her white blouse. Ancher’s brushwork is delicate yet deliberate, with loose Impressionist touches in the play of light, while retaining the quiet dignity of realist portraiture. As one of the few professionally trained female artists of the Skagen colony, her depictions of women’s private moments challenged traditional gender narratives, cementing her legacy as a pioneer of Nordic domestic realism.
